The 2016–17 Israeli Women's Cup (Hebrew: גביע המדינה נשים , Gvia HaMedina Nashim) was the 19th season of Israel's women's nationwide football cup competition. The competition began on 29 November 2016 with 4 first round matches.

ASA Tel Aviv University won the cup, beating Maccabi Kishronot Hadera 2–1 in the final.[1]
